To start I masked off a strip to one side and stamped a background birthday text stamp in black. I then added a strip of NitWits paper down the left hand side.
For the main focus of my card I used one of the Boxed Blooms which I stamped and heat embossed in white. I then used a Versamark pen to draw another square around the box then embossed again in white.
I used the colours in the DP in DIs to colour the bloom using a w/c technique. I extended the petals and stem into the space between the stamp and the extra border with a couple of brush strokes then filled the background with a blue wash.
The happy was stamped using part of a Bloom Sketches phrase in black and the birthday was diecut using a Spellbinders die from black card.
